智力游戏作为一种结合了娱乐和教育价值的互动体验,越来越受到人们的喜爱。开发既能启智又受欢迎的智力游戏,需要从多个角度进行综合考虑。以下是一些关键步骤和策略:

一、市场调研与需求分析

1. 目标用户群体

首先,明确你的目标用户群体。不同的年龄层、职业背景和兴趣爱好的人,对智力游戏的需求是不同的。例如,儿童可能更偏好寓教于乐的游戏,而成年人可能更倾向于挑战性和策略性强的游戏。

2. 市场趋势

了解当前智力游戏市场的趋势,包括流行的游戏类型、功能特点以及用户反馈。这有助于你找到市场空白点,开发出更具竞争力的产品。

二、游戏设计

1. 游戏主题与内容

选择一个有趣且富有教育意义的主题,确保游戏内容既能启发思维,又能吸引玩家。例如,结合历史、科学、文学等领域的知识,设计出独特的游戏关卡。

2. 游戏机制

设计合理的游戏机制是关键。以下是一些常见的智力游戏机制:

  • 拼图类:通过拼图完成画面,锻炼空间想象力和逻辑思维。
  • 解谜类:通过解决谜题,培养逻辑推理和问题解决能力。
  • 记忆类:通过记忆卡片、数字等方式,提高记忆力。
  • 策略类:通过布局和策略,锻炼决策能力和前瞻性思维。

3. 游戏难度分级

为不同水平的玩家提供相应的难度选择,让游戏更具包容性。可以从入门级到专家级,逐步提高难度。

三、技术实现

1. 开发工具与平台

选择合适的开发工具和平台,如Unity、Unreal Engine等。根据游戏类型和目标平台(如iOS、Android、PC等)进行选择。

2. 代码示例

以下是一个简单的拼图游戏代码示例(使用Unity C#):

public class PuzzlePiece : MonoBehaviour
{
    public Vector2 targetPosition;
    private bool isDragging;

    void Update()
    {
        if (isDragging)
        {
            transform.position = Vector2.Lerp(transform.position, targetPosition, 0.1f);
        }
    }

    public void OnMouseDown()
    {
        isDragging = true;
    }

    public void OnMouseUp()
    {
        isDragging = false;
        if (Vector2.Distance(transform.position, targetPosition) < 0.1f)
        {
            // 成功拼图
        }
    }
}

3. 优化与测试

在开发过程中,不断优化游戏性能,确保流畅运行。同时,进行充分的测试,确保游戏无bug,并收集用户反馈进行改进。

四、推广与运营

1. 渠道选择

选择合适的推广渠道,如应用商店、社交媒体、游戏论坛等。针对不同平台的特点,制定相应的推广策略。

2. 营销活动

举办线上线下活动,提高游戏知名度。例如,举办比赛、发布更新、合作推广等。

3. 用户反馈

关注用户反馈,及时调整游戏策略,提升用户体验。

五、总结

开发既能启智又受欢迎的智力游戏,需要从市场调研、游戏设计、技术实现、推广运营等多个方面进行综合考虑。通过不断优化和创新,相信你能够打造出令人满意的作品。